雏鹰部落

 找回密码
 立即注册

QQ登录

只需一步,快速开始

搜索
查看: 4070|回复: 6

[讨论/求助] 为什么说PPTP是二层的VPN?

  [复制链接]
发表于 2010-4-27 10:16:46 | 显示全部楼层 |阅读模式
为什么说PPTP是二层的VPN?不是很理解~求解~烦请举例~~
发表于 2010-4-27 10:31:02 | 显示全部楼层
先给段2层VPN的总体说明:
第二层隧道协议用于传输第二层网络协议,它主要应用于构建Access VPN。第二层隧道协议主要有3种:一种是由Cisco、Nortel等公司支持的L2F协议,Cisco路由器中支持此协议;另一种是Microsoft、**end、3COM等公司支持的PPTP协议,Windows NT 4.0以上版本中支持此协议;而成为二层隧道协议工业标准的是由IETF起草并由Microsoft、**end、Cisco、3COM等公司参与制定的L2TP协议,它结合了上述两个协议的优点。

隧道协议,其数据包格式都是由乘客协议、封装协议和传输协议3部分组成的。

L2F(Layer Two Forwarding Protocol,二层转发协议)是由Cisco公司提出的隧道技术,可以支持多种传输协议,如IP、ATM、帧中继。

PPTP(Point-to-Point Tunneling Protocol,点到点隧道协议)在RFC2637中定义,该协议将PPP数据包封装在IP数据包内通过IP网络(如Internet或Intranet)进行传送。PPTP协议可看作是PPP协议的一种扩展,它提供了一种在Internet上建立多协议的VPN的通信方式,远端用户能够通过任何支持PPTP的ISP访问公司的专用网络。

L2TP(Layer Two Protocol,第二层隧道协议)由RFC2661定义,它结合了L2F和PPTP的优点,可以让用户从客户端或访问服务器端发起VPN连接。L2TP是由Cisco、Microsoft等公司在1999年联合制定的,已经成为二层隧道协议的工业标准,并得到了众多网络厂商的支持。

PPTP和L2TP都使用PPP协议对数据进行封装。然后添加附加包头用于数据在互联网络上的传输。尽管两个协议非常相似,但是仍存在以下几方面的不同:

(1)PPTP要求互联网络为IP网络,L2TP只要求隧道媒介提供面向数据包的点对点的连接。

(2)PPTP只能在两端点间建立单一隧道。

(3)L2TP可以提供包头压缩。

(4)L2TP可以提供隧道验证,而PPTP则不支持隧道验证。
发表于 2010-4-27 13:53:49 | 显示全部楼层
楼上解释得很好,赞一个
发表于 2010-4-27 19:40:30 | 显示全部楼层
VPN目前如果要用的话,通过查找资料,可以完成配置,就是对有些VPN的细节还是不太清楚,需要学习啊…………
发表于 2010-5-20 22:42:32 | 显示全部楼层
好帖。顶顶顶
发表于 2010-5-22 20:30:47 | 显示全部楼层
楼上解释得很好,赞一个
发表于 2010-5-23 13:49:17 | 显示全部楼层
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

QQ|熊猫同学技术论坛|小黑屋| 网络工程师论坛 ( 沪ICP备09076391 )

GMT+8, 2024-10-6 06:46 , Processed in 0.073157 second(s), 18 queries , Gzip On.

快速回复 返回顶部 返回列表